MEMO — Film reel transfer, Oldcroft Archive. Fourteen canisters of nitrate-era film reels move from the Penhallow vault to the Oldcroft Archive on Wednesday. Canisters stay sealed and upright, climate-controlled van only, no other cargo. Two staff load, driver does not handle canisters directly. Manifest rides in the cab, copy stays with the vault clerk. Arrival window is 10:00–12:00; archive staff receive at the rear dock only. Coordinator gives the courier this hand-over instruction before departure.

dispatch memo: the lamwyn fenwyn courier leaves the wenir ledger at gate 7175 under passcode 822969

Hey — handover for the Bramblewick partner SFTP drop. Their nightly file lands around 02:15; if it's missing by 03:00, the ingest job will page you. Usually it's just their side running late, so wait one cycle before poking anyone. The drop directory moved last week to the new host, and the watcher config already points there. If you need to re-mount the encrypted landing volume after a restart, the recovery phrase is below.

strongbox words: zorwyn-sorael-belion-ulaius-silmir-ulays-briax-rusdor-gorix

# Heads up, future maintainer of the Crashwick pipeline!
# This env drives the mobile crash-report ingest for the Pebbletone app.
# Reports land in the Sifter queue, get symbolicated, then ship to the
# dashboard. If symbolication starts failing, it's almost always because
# someone rotated the ingest credential and forgot to update this file.
# Don't reorder these lines — Sifter's parser is picky and bails on the
# first unknown key. The ingest credential belongs on the very next line
# after this comment.

vault entry, kawep-yahof: LEDGER_TOKEN29=aed31a7c3a275025cbea1ab2c10a7